Over the 12 years from 2014 to 2025, Carroll County recorded 405 distinct power outage events, averaging 2.6 hours per event.

The single worst outage on record in Carroll County started April 29, 2021 (Thunderstorm Wind), lasting 2 hours and leaving up to 10,786 customers without power (61% of the county) at its peak.

May has historically been the worst month for outages in Carroll County, with 53 events recorded during that month across the dataset.

Based on this history, Carroll County earns a Reliability Grade of D, placing it in the 37th percentile nationally for grid reliability (higher percentile = more reliable).
